How far is Nouvo City Hotel from the airport?

Nouvo City Hotel sits in the Phra Nakhon district, roughly 30–40 minutes by taxi from Suvarnabhumi Airport (BKK) depending on traffic, and about 25 minutes from Don Mueang International Airport (DMK). No official shuttle is listed on the booking platforms we reviewed, but taxis and ride-hailing services are widely available. The hotel’s front desk is staffed 24/7, making late arrivals straightforward (Trip.com).

For budget travellers, the Airport Rail Link from Suvarnabhumi to Phaya Thai station, followed by a short taxi ride, is a common alternative. The hotel’s location in the old city means it’s convenient for sightseeing but not directly on the rapid transit lines.

The bottom line: Driving time to both airports is moderate, and the 24-hour front desk eases late arrivals, but you’ll need a taxi or ride service for the final leg.

Which is the best part of Bangkok to stay in?

Nouvo City Hotel is located in the Old City (Rattanakosin), near Khaosan Road. This area is the cultural heart of Bangkok, packed with temples, markets, and history. The hotel is a 10-minute walk from Banglamphu Market, and the Grand Palace and Wat Pho are within easy walking distance (TripAdvisor location score 4.3/5).

Other popular districts offer different trade-offs:

  • Sukhumvit – Modern shopping, nightlife, and BTS Skytrain access. More expensive and less historic.
  • Silom / Sathorn – Business district with rooftop bars and good transport links. Quieter on weekends.
  • Riverside – Luxury hotels with river views, but fewer budget options and less walkable to temples.
  • Ratchada – Known for night markets and entertainment, but farther from the old city sights.

For a first-time visitor focused on temples and markets, the Old City is the most convenient base. Nouvo City Hotel’s position – close to the main attractions but far enough from Khaosan Road’s party zone – strikes a balance that many reviewers appreciate. One TripAdvisor guest noted, “The hotel is located close to main touristic areas but also far away from the party zone.”

Why this matters: If your priority is sightseeing in the historic core, the Old City is the best area, and Nouvo City Hotel’s location is a strong fit. For nightlife or shopping, Sukhumvit or Silom might suit better.

Location and getting there

Nouvo City Hotel is at 2 Samsen Road, Ban Phan Thom, Phra Nakhon, Bangkok 10200. The surrounding streets are a mix of local shops, cafes, and small temples. The hotel is about 10 minutes on foot from Banglamphu Market and 15–20 minutes from the Grand Palace and Wat Pho, depending on your pace.

From Suvarnabhumi Airport, a taxi typically takes 30–40 minutes (toll costs extra). Alternatively, take the Airport Rail Link to Phaya Thai, then a taxi or tuk-tuk (about 15 minutes). From Don Mueang, a taxi is about 25–30 minutes. No official airport shuttle is listed on the booking platforms.

The hotel offers parking on site, which is a rare benefit in the old city’s narrow streets. For getting around, the nearest public transport is the Chao Phraya Express Boat (Tha Phra Chan pier, about 15 minutes’ walk), and taxi or tuk-tuk are the most practical options for short trips.

Tip: The Chao Phraya River boats are a scenic and cheap way to reach Silom, Sathorn, or the Riverside area. The hotel’s proximity to the river makes this a viable option.
